Contact

Address:
132 Small Lode
Upwell
Wisbech PE14 9BL
United Kingdom

Location on map

Nearby companies

4wire
Distance: 1.11 miles
St Peter Parish Church
Distance: 1.11 miles
Smart Dog Design
Distance: 1.22 miles
Dr D Rattray
Distance: 1.42 miles
Dr S P Millard
Distance: 1.42 miles

Company description

Upwell Computers offers Computer Stores services in Wisbech, England area.

Reviews

There are no reviews for Upwell Computers.